Abstract
Laminated fiber-strengthened composites are a hybrid composite class that combines fibrouscomposites with lamination processes. Fiber-reinforced materials are used in the layer. Every
fibres were arranged in such that they provide desired characteristics and stiffness. Therefore, the
main favoured viewpoint with fibre reinforced composite materials seems to be that suitable
lamination processes may provide quality and rigidity in a particular direction. Polaris missile
shells, fibreglass boat hulls, aircraft wing panels & body sections, tennis rackets, or golf club shafts
are all examples of laminated fiber-reinforced composites.
